Factors to Consider When Choosing Bike Tires
Choosing the right bike tire involves more than just finding the right size. Here are some important factors to keep in mind when selecting 26 inch tires at Walmart:
Tire Type and Tread
The type of tire and its tread pattern play a significant role in your bike's performance. Smooth tires are great for paved roads, offering low rolling resistance and a fast ride. Knobby tires, on the other hand, provide better grip on off-road trails. Consider the type of riding you'll be doing most often when choosing your 26 inch tires. If you ride on a variety of surfaces, a hybrid tire with a moderate tread pattern might be the best option.
Tire Pressure
Proper tire pressure is crucial for optimal performance, comfort, and safety. Check the recommended tire pressure range printed on the sidewall of the 26 inch tires. Use a bike pump with a pressure gauge to inflate your tires to the correct pressure. Underinflated tires can lead to a sluggish ride and increase the risk of pinch flats, while overinflated tires can make the ride harsh and reduce traction. Maintaining the correct tire pressure will enhance your riding experience and prolong the life of your tires.
Puncture Resistance
Punctures are a common nuisance for cyclists, so choosing 26 inch tires with good puncture resistance is a smart move. Look for tires that have built-in puncture protection layers, such as Kevlar or other reinforced materials. These layers help to prevent sharp objects from penetrating the tire and causing flats. Investing in puncture-resistant tires can save you time, money, and frustration in the long run, allowing you to enjoy your rides without worrying about frequent flats.

Tips for Maintaining Your Bike Tires
Once you've found the perfect 26 inch bike tires at Walmart, proper maintenance will help extend their lifespan and keep you rolling smoothly. Here are a few tips:
Regularly Check Tire Pressure
Make it a habit to check your tire pressure before each ride. Proper inflation not only improves performance but also reduces the risk of flats and tire damage. Use a reliable bike pump with a pressure gauge to ensure your tires are inflated to the recommended pressure. Maintaining consistent tire pressure will also contribute to a more comfortable and enjoyable riding experience.
Inspect for Wear and Damage
Periodically inspect your 26 inch tires for signs of wear and damage. Look for cuts, cracks, bulges, or embedded objects. If you notice any significant damage, replace the tire immediately to prevent blowouts or other safety hazards. Regular inspections will help you identify potential problems early on, allowing you to address them before they escalate into more serious issues.
Rotate Your Tires
To promote even wear, consider rotating your bike tires periodically. The rear tire typically wears out faster than the front tire due to the weight distribution and drive forces. Swapping the front and rear tires can help to extend the overall lifespan of both tires. Consult your bike's manual or a professional mechanic for guidance on the proper tire rotation procedure.
Store Your Bike Properly
Proper storage can also help to prolong the life of your 26 inch tires. Avoid storing your bike in direct sunlight or extreme temperatures, as these conditions can cause the tires to deteriorate over time. If you're storing your bike for an extended period, consider deflating the tires slightly to reduce stress on the sidewalls. Storing your bike in a cool, dry place will help to keep your tires in good condition and ready for your next ride.
